Special Education Clerk

 

Role Mission: The Special Education Clerk plays a vital role in supporting the district’s special education program by providing clerical, records management, and administrative support to the Special Education Lead Team.  This position is responsible for ensuring compliance with state and federal regulations, maintaining accurate student records, and assisting with financial and logistical tasks related to special education services.  The Special Education Clerk also facilitates communication between departments and staff, ensuring that all requests and tasks are handled efficiently and professionally.     
 

Supervisory Responsibilities: None 

 

Location: ​​This is a full-time hybrid position based in Austin, with preference given to candidates who live in the region, or who are willing to relocate. 

 

Travel Expectations: ​​ None 

 

What You’ll Do – Accountabilities 

Essential Duties: 

  • Review and audit PEIMS reports regularly to track meetings and ensure accurate documentation   
  • Organize, sort, and monitor student records, ensuring all required documentation is received and notify the Special Education Manager of any missing information  
  • Utilize the STREAM report to identify newly enrolled special education students; promptly request records from previous districts and update tracking systems for leadership use  
  • Accurately input and audit Individual Education Plan (IEP) data into the district’s Student Information System  
  • Utilize trackers to provide Progress to Goals (PTGs) to the special education team for monitoring student progress and compliance 
  • Request and manage student records through Texas Records Exchange (TREx), Frontline eSPED, phone calls, emails, faxes, and any other available methods, ensuring compliance with FERPA guidelines and department procedures  

 

Additional Duties and Responsibilities:  

  • Conduct periodic eligibility folder audits to ensure compliance with federal and state regulations   
  • Manage special education supply orders and submit purchase order requests   
  • Request various medical forms from doctors' offices and work with regional campus clerks to process REQs for doctor payments  
  • Process employee travel reimbursements for professional development and ensure submissions are completed by the business office’s designated due date   
  • Maintain financial records, receipts, and logs for auditing purposes   
  • Reconcile credit card transactions and prepare accurate monthly expense reports for review and submission  
  • Coordinate travel arrangements for the special education team and assist in organizing regional professional development and training logistics   
  • Ensure Medicaid consent compliance  
  • Responsible for tracking SSA/DDS requests, ensuring all required forms are completed and records collected, and forwarding the full packet to the designated staff member for submission  
  • Respond to all emails, phone calls, Frontline requests, and other inquiries within 48 hours  
  • Foster positive interpersonal relationships with staff and parents while upholding confidentiality and adhering to district policies, administrative procedures, and federal/state laws

Required Education and Experience:  

Education: Associates degree or some college preferred   
 
Strong background in administrative support, records management, and compliance tracking, particularly within an educational or special education setting  
 
Understanding of FERPA regulations and handling confidential student records   

 

Preferred Education and Experience: N/A 

 

Physical Requirements: 

Sit for long periods of time, lift up to 15lbs
